Q01What is the pincode of Khersa?
+
The pincode of Khersa, Atrauli tehsil, Aligarh district, Uttar Pradesh is 202129. The post office is Kauriyaganj.
Q02Which post office delivers to Khersa?
+
Mail for Khersa is delivered through Kauriyaganj post office, pincode 202129, in Atrauli tehsil, Aligarh district. Use the full village name and the pincode on envelopes and courier forms.
Q03In which district is Khersa located?
+
Khersa is a village in Atrauli tehsil of Aligarh district, Uttar Pradesh, India.
Q04What is the population of Khersa as per Census 2011?
+
As per the 2011 Census, Khersa village has a population of 1,222 across 201 households.

Q06Which Lok Sabha constituency is Khersa in?
+
Khersa falls under the Aonla Lok Sabha constituency (PC #24) of Uttar Pradesh.
Q07Which Vidhan Sabha (assembly) constituency is Khersa in?
+
Khersa falls under the Shekhupur assembly constituency (AC #116) of Uttar Pradesh.
Q08What is the literacy rate in Khersa?
+
The Census 2011 literacy rate for Khersa village is 51.0%.
Q09What is the sex ratio in Khersa?
+
The Census 2011 sex ratio for Khersa village is 903 females per 1,000 males.
